Output 173a9aea2c4f60447c60ddc229099e13156d0e47ed83b140a2ba3ecc03fc138f:76

value
2097152
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d8582159ceff62277539c19f78215191877565c3230497d97ea6629ed584606b
address
bc1pmpvzzkwwla3zwafecx0hsg23jxrh2ewryvzf0kt75e3fa4vyvp4smssyyu
transaction
173a9aea2c4f60447c60ddc229099e13156d0e47ed83b140a2ba3ecc03fc138f
spent
true